Cleared at 3 weeks post hysterectomy

I had my 2nd post-op appointment on the 23rd. My hysterecomerty was on the 4th of December. While I was at my appointment my dr opened the exam room door and said; you look like your walking good and doing good, so I will see you in a year. I asked about the lump at the end of my incision and she came over and looked. She explained it was where she tied off the stitches and it would make my belly flat.

She walked out of the room and said...your uterus did not have dysphasia like we suspected but don't beat yourself up about having the hysterecomerty, the cervical dysphasia and endometriosis would have lead to this anyway.

That was it, she left the room. I don't have a clue what to do, what to expect, or my next move. My FMLA paperwork clears me to work on January 10th. I'm a critical care paramedic; how do I adjust back into lifting and exercising. I will be lifting, pushing, pulling, climbing and all kinds of things once I am back at work.

I am very sad I had a hystercomety so soon when it sounded like it was needed this soon. My heart aches and I feel totally lost. Any direction you could give me on this would be greatly appreciated.

Re: Cleared at 3 weeks post hysterectomy

call and get some clarification. Find out how much you can lift and when, whether you have bending restrictions, when you can return to sexual activity etc. I don't think the doctor saying see you in a year means - ok go out and do whatever you want. Even if that is what she meant, try to pay attention to what your body tells you as you get back to your regular life. If you start bleeding or having a lot of pain you need to go a bit slower.
